Yeah..I heard it. Nasser Husain should have used his words a bit carefully, he was in a commentators role and could have avoided speaking something like this, here is the part of the news article printed in DNA newspaper

" Hussain slammed the BCCI for not making the full use of the DRS and called it a "disgrace".

Shastri, a fellow commentator, while replying to a question on Star Cricket, made a scathing attack on Hussain, saying that England are jealous of India's world number one status and BCCI's big purse.

"England are jealous about the way IPL is going, jealous that India is No.1 in world cricket, jealous that India are world champions. They are jealous because of the too much money being made by BCCI. Bottom-line is that they have never been No. 1 in the world in Test cricket," said Shastri.

That was not all as on third day of second Test today, Shastri and Hussain clashed again while commentating together with the latter picking up from what was left yesterday.

"Ravi, I just want to pick you up on something you said on a show yesterday, questioning my right to call non-use of DRS a disgrace. Well, I have earned that right after 96 Tests to voice my opinion on cricket. It is my job and my right to voice my opinion," Hussain said.

Harbhajan was expected to play at least the containing role. Just read he has a stomach injury, still his bowling average in the past two years have been 40 and 38. His strike rates;85 and 78. This compared to a career average of 32 and strike rate of 68. This at a time when India has done very well in the test arena. He does not seem to trouble the batsmen any more.
